Colorado’s Department of Early Childhood lists each program’s complaints on its Colorado Shines page, with the department’s verdict on each and a report behind it, going back about three years. Older complaints are released only on request. The department does not rank complaints by severity in either place.

Founded · 7.702.62.A.2 · General Requirement/Physical Care · Correction due June 12, 2023
The time a child arrives and leaves the center each day must be recorded. Staff members must complete written attendance verification periodically throughout the day, including during transitions.
Required correction: The time a child arrives and leaves the center must be recorded each day. Correct immediately and submit a plan for future compliance with written response to specialist.
Founded · 7.702.32.A · General Requirement/Physical Care · Correction due June 12, 2023
For security purposes, a sign-in/sign-out sheet or other mechanism for parents/guardians, or staff if children are being transported, must be maintained daily by the center. It must include, for each child in care, the date, the child's name, the time when the child arrived at and left the center, and the parent /guardian or staff member's signature or other unique identifier. For children who are transported, parent(s)/guardian(s) must verify the accuracy of the sign-in/sign-out sheet at least weekly.
Required correction: A sign in/out sheet must be maintained daily by the center. If children are being transported staff must sign children in/out and parents/guardians must verify the accuracy of the sign in/out sheet at least weekly. Correct immediately and submit a plan of action for signing children into the facility when transported and how parents/guardians will verify the accuracy of the sing in/out sheet weekly.
